Tablet/card weaving

Tablet weaving is an ancient technique (about 3000 years old) of making decorative clothes borders from wool, linen, silk, horsehair, silver and gold threads or whatever other material they had access to at the time. Tablet woven bands were used in the past as trims, belts, headbands or leg wraps. Compared to metal finds not many tablet woven pieces have survived to our times but those which have and can now be seen in museums all over Europe show variety of patterns, from simple geometric to very complex heraldic.
